Output 74bf88b14d8fee590ea3df07c194c286f0873928f40371611654a9678f4d691e:0

value
386403
script pubkey
OP_0 OP_PUSHBYTES_20 cd339a088cfa9218677631993899c18f0db6b9d4
address
bc1qe5ee5zyvl2fpsemkxxvn3xwp3uxmdww5udndrz
transaction
74bf88b14d8fee590ea3df07c194c286f0873928f40371611654a9678f4d691e
spent
true